Learn to implement object detection for bone fractures using YOLOv8 and Python in this 26-minute tutorial video. Follow step-by-step instructions to load a trained YOLO model, process images, and visualize predictions and ground truth annotations. Discover how to import the YOLOv8 model from the Ultralytics library, interpret annotation data from YAML files, train the model with a custom dataset, and make predictions by drawing bounding boxes around detected fractures. Access the provided code, dataset link, and additional resources to enhance your computer vision skills in medical imaging applications.
